Job Prospects and Issues
The creation of casinos often results in a significant increase in employment opportunities within regional economies. These venues require a varied workforce, ranging from dealers and cashiers to hospitality staff and security personnel. Many casinos also generate ancillary jobs in surrounding businesses, such as restaurants, hotels, and transportation services. As a result, locals may find various job openings that cover different skill levels, which helps reduce unemployment levels in the region.
However, while the influx of jobs can be considered a positive development, there are challenges that accompany this growth. The nature of employment in casinos can be precarious, with many positions being part-time or temporary rather than full-time jobs with benefits. Employees may encounter irregular hours and shift work, which can impact their quality of life. Additionally, the frequent staff changes in the casino industry can lead to a continual cycle of recruitment and training, creating further stress for both employers and employees.
Moreover, the jobs created by casinos may not consistently offer competitive wages, particularly for beginner positions. Despite the potential for higher earnings in tips and commissions for specific roles, many workers may find it difficult to earn a sufficient income. This situation can lead to challenges for local communities as well, where dependence on casino jobs may not provide sustained economic stability. Consequently, while casinos can boost employment, it is crucial to address the disparities in job quality and security to ensure sustainable economic growth.
Social Impacts and Community Considerations
The introduction of casino games in local economies often leads to a blend of positive and negative social impacts. On one hand, casinos can generate employment prospects, lure tourists, and generate income for local enterprises. This influx can help revitalize struggling areas, as increased foot traffic can benefit restaurants, hotels, and stores in the vicinity. The community may experience an economic uplift that can foster growth and enhancement in community services.
However, the presence of casino games can also lead to a rise in gambling issues, which affects not only the individuals involved but also their loved ones and the broader community. Issues such as economic hardship, increased criminal activity, and psychological concerns often emerge as gambling becomes a prevalent activity. It is essential for local governments and community groups to tackle these issues through education and support services, helping those affected by gambling addiction while encouraging responsible gaming behaviors.
